Gospel Concert Friday, October 25, 2013 Benefiting the Youth at Risk Scholarship Fund (6185 hits)

Long Island, New York – On Friday October 25, 2013 STW Advocacy for at Risk Youth will be presenting a Gospel Benefit our scholarship fund; awarding scholarships to youth striving for a higher education at a University, College of Trade School of their Choice.

The Gospel Concert will take place at the African American Museum 110 North Franklin Street, Hempstead, New York 11550. The Concert will begin promptly at 7:00 p.m.

An evening of Gospel featuring Alyssa-Marie Prendergast & Sam Simpson & The Gospel Suns

About: STW Advocacy for at Risk Youth, Inc. is a Non-for-Profit organization whose mission is to provide support to deserving students on Long Island by awarding scholarships, volunteering at after school programs and youth centers, holding dialog sessions on topics concerning today’s youths, donating, back to school supplies, and introducing youth to career opportunities.
